Granite Transformations has renovated two kitchens in Rise Hall, a 19th century manor house in Yorkshire.
The manor – which is owned and has been restored by TV presenter Sarah Beeny and her artist husband Graham Swift – saw Granite Transformations renovate the Butler's Pantry and an en suite installation in the hall managers’ live-in quarters.
In the manor's kitchens, Granite Transformations used its Sachi granite finish overlaid onto worktops and grease-resistant splashbacks and oven surrounds.
“We found working alongside Sarah and Graham most inspiring, since they explored fresh applications for our surface finishes,” said Granite Transformations' COO Danny Hanlon. “Even on this phase, they’ve managed to challenge us with an en suite kitchen and elegant upgrade of a classic butler’s pantry.”
The company has previously renovated Rise Hall's bathrooms, which had been styled by the couple and prompted Granite Transformations to branch into bathroom renovation alongside its core kitchen business.
